10 DUNDEE. [Forfarshire
Justices of the Peace for Dundee and District — Continued.
Shepherd, John H. Luis, Jas. Guthrie, Win. Robertson, John Adamson,
James Allan, Hugh Ballingall, David Greig, M.D.; A. D. Grimond, John
Guild, A. Henderson, James Low, Duncan Macdonald, John Robertson, James
Shaw, W. J. Small, W. G. Thomson. Clerk— Thomas Congleton, 20 Castle
street. Procurator-Fiscal — Alexander Agnew, 11 Reform street.
Consuls and Vice-Consuls for Foreign States.
Argentine Republic (Consul) ... ... Thomas Murdoch, 62 St Andrew st.
Belgium, Denmark, and Netherlands ... T. W. Thorns, 18 St Andrew's place
Brazil ... ... ... ... ... Thomas Collier, 13 Albert square
Chili ... ... ... ... ... George C. Keiller, 33 MeadoAvside
France ... .. ... ... ... P. M. Cochrane, 1 Dudhope terrace
German Empire (Consul) H. Quosbarth, 46 Castle street
Greece (Consular Agent) William B. Ritchie, 33 Dock street
Hawaii ... ... ... ... .. John G. Zoller, 87 Commercial st.
Italy ... ... ... ... ... James Millar, 54 Commercial street
Liberia (Consul) D. F. Robertson, 25 Dock street
Peru (Consul) ... ... .. ... James H. Bell, 2 India buildings
Portugal, Sweden, and Norway ... Bernt Pettersen, 46 Castle street
Russia ... ... ... ... ... William B. Wilson, 4 Panmure street
Spain (Vice-Consul) ... ... ... I. Julius Weinberg, 13 Panmure st.
United States (Consul) ... .. W. B. Wells. 81 Murraygate
United States (Vice and Deputy Consul) William MTntyre, 81 Murraygate
United States of Columbia & Venezuela Thomas M. Ferrier, 11 Panmure st
Conveyances.
CONVEYANCE BY RAILWAY
On the Perth and Dundee Section of the Caledonian Line (Northern Division).
Station, South Union street ; stationmaster, Alexander Lamb ; traffic
superintendent, George Thompson ; assistant traffic superintendent, Peter
Crystall ; goods agent, David Conacher ; carting agent, Hugh Grant, South
Union street.
Station, Magdalen Green ; J. C. Monteith, stationmaster.
Station, Baldragon ; James Campbell, stationmaster.
Station, Longforgan ; Andrew Grant, stationmaster.
On the Neictyle and Blairgowrie Section of the Caledonian Line.
Station, Baldovan ; James Adamson, stationmaster.
Station 9 Baldragon ; James Campbell, stationmaster.
Station, Liff ; John Anderson, stationmaster.
On the North British Line (Northern Division).
Station (Tay Bridge), South Union street ; stationmaster, James Smith ;
goods manager, David Deuchars ; goods agent, William Dott ; carting agents,
Mutter, Howey, & Co., 24 Cowgate (James Slidders, agent).
On the Dundee and Arbroath Joint Line (Caledonian and North British
Railways).
Office, 65 Commercial Street.
Station, East Dock street ; manager and secretaiy, Edward Gilbert ;
goods agent, James M'Farlane ; stationmaster, A. F. Himter ; parting agents,
Mutter, Howey. & Co., 24 Cowgate (James Slidders, agent), Wordie & Co.,
South Union street (Hugh Grant, agent).
